Asset Manager:

Spark Power, a trusted partner in energy in North America, is looking for a  Asset Manager  to join our US team. The Asset Manager acts as the primary point of contact for customer inquiries, acts to maintain customer relationships, leads or managers flow of projects, ensures budgets, margins, and timelines are met, and personnel resources are available. They are also responsible for sourcing out new opportunities within a customer's facility, quoting jobs, and following up with customers. This role requires you to travel at some level of frequency annually.

What will do you as the  Asset Manager ?

  • Contract management
  • Detailed understanding of all obligations including service responsibilities, response times, reporting scope of work, billing rates, termination clauses, etc.
  • Customer direct contact
  • Technical ownership:
  • Project electrical and mechanical design
  • Operational understanding (design theory)
  • Management of site turnover documentation
  • Spare parts management (procurement and inventory)
  • Warranty and RMA tracking
  • Recommendations and suggestions for improvement
  • Site safety and documentation
  • Asset operating plans
  • Preventative maintenance obligations and scheduling
  • Corrective maintenance strategy (change order management, fixed price projects, etc.)
  • Ticket management, escalation and close out
  • Capital expenditure/Operational expenditure recommendations and management
  • Co-ordination with field service dispatching
  • Financial accountability (Project & Portfolio level P&L)
  • Preventative maintenance tracking
  • Corrective maintenance job tracking
  • Subcontractor management
  • Quoting and procurement for chargeable service work
  • Performance/Availability guarantee (if applicable)
  • Operational requirements
  • Review and delivery (if applicable) of all field reporting
  • Review of production and performance reporting (if applicable)
  • Daily monitoring of SCADA (in parallel with Operations Centre's (ROC) monitoring platform)
  • Travel to customer assets as required
